Men and women dealing with this ailment have a constant situation getting rid of their belongings. This leads to litter which can disrupt their means of living with Other people. They conserve random goods they deem as vital or Keeping price and retail outlet them in locations that can cause dangerous circumstances.  

Compulsive hoarding is really an irresistible urge to build up stuff. A hoarder can not basically ‘flip a switch’ and end hoarding.

Commence small by asking if there is a class of items These are ready to go through and permit you to discard. For example, “I discover plenty of vacant paper cups. Will you allow for me to undergo your property and discard them?”

"The difference with someone who incorporates a hoarding trouble, having said that, is their Extraordinary psychological attachment to points—they would sense very upset or threatened if everyone tidied up, cleaned or taken out their objects.

Hoarding laws in California deal with the sophisticated difficulty of hoarding conduct and its effect on safety, sanitation, and housing problems. These legal guidelines are generally enforced on the nearby amount by developing, overall health, and security codes.
